Or say it could be something like that
#define __sockaddr(type, src) \
({ build_sockaddr_check(sizeof(type)); (type *) src; })
and say in function af_inet.c:inet_getname instead of
struct sockaddr_in *sin = (struct sockaddr_in *)uaddr;
we may write like
struct sockaddr_in *sin = __sockaddr(struct sockaddr_in, uaddr);
which would check the size.
